    One for the Howa Mini today - thankful for the wee cheapskate’s precision and lightness for this shot. Used a thin leather sling as a shooter sling resting the elbows on my knees, really steadies things up… Sat ready to go for about 20 minutes, waiting for this guy to browse out from behind cover. Had a fully numb bum when it was time to stand up from the crown fern.

    70gr Speer semi-point, about 3150fps. No quibble.

    Quote Originally Posted by Hunty1 View Post
    @Flyblown what's the load? That's quite fast for a 70gr isn't it? Just curious as my 75gr ELD Load only does 2750 out my howa.
    @Hunty1, I should have the raw chrono speeds in a file somewhere. I remember being surprised at the speed, but then it is a hottish load of 2206H. Certainly above ADI book max but IIRC about the same as another source’s book max. My Howa is 20” barrel.

    But I do remember tuning the velocity and the BC to fit the drop data, which was a lot less drop than I expected at 300m. So I think the velocity and the BC both went up so I got a curve that matched the other drops. It hits where its supposed to farther out so, guess that’s what counts.
